Saturday, October 24, 2026 2:00-3:30 PM Calling all volunteers interested in helping CHA restore and maintain our native garden! Whether you attended a prior volunteer meeting or not, we welcome you to join our next work day in October. We are incredibly thankful to the individuals who assisted in the spring and over the summer, and we thank you in advance for considering involvement this fall. At this work day, you will join staff members of CHA to combat invasive plants and improve the size and health of our native pollinator garden. Bring a kneeling mat, gardening gloves, and your favorite weeding tool. Gardeners of all skill levels and experience are welcome. Whether you are a master gardener or an interested individual just starting to learn, we can use your help! Event is weather dependent. Registrants will be informed via email or phone if the meeting must be cancelled.
